Abstract
Social network strategy (SNS) testing uses network connections to refer individuals at high risk to HIV testing services (HTS). In Tanzania, SNS testing is offered in communities and health facilities. In communities, SNS testing targets key and vulnerable populations (KVP), while in health facilities it complements index testing by reaching unelicited index contacts. Routine data were used to assess performance and trends over time in PEPFAR-supported sites between October 2021 and March 2023. Key indicators included SNS social contacts tested, and new HIV-positives individuals identified. Descriptive and statistical analysis were conducted. Univariable and multivariable analysis were applied, and variables with P-values <0.2 at univariable analysis were considered for multivariable analysis. Overall, 121,739 SNS contacts were tested, and 7731 (6.4%) previously undiagnosed individuals living with HIV were identified. Tested contacts and identified HIV-positives were mostly aged ≥15 years (>99.7%) and females (80.6% of tests, 79.4% of HIV-positives). Most SNS contacts were tested (78,363; 64.7%) and diagnosed (6376; 82.5%) in communities. SNS tests and HIV-positives grew 11.5 and 6.1-fold respectively, from October-December 2021 to January-March 2023, with majority of clients reached in communities vs. facilities (78,763 vs. 42,976). These results indicate that SNS testing is a promising HIV case-finding approach in Tanzania.

Abstract
Objectives Reduction in maternal and newborn mortality requires that women deliver in high quality health facilities. However, many facilities provide sub‐optimal quality of care, which may be a reason for less than universal facility utilisation. We assessed the impact of a quality improvement project on facility utilisation for childbirth. Methods In this cluster‐randomised experiment in four rural districts in Tanzania, 12 primary care clinics and their catchment areas received a quality improvement intervention consisting of in‐service training, mentoring and supportive supervision, infrastructure support, and peer outreach, while 12 facilities and their catchment areas functioned as controls. We conducted a census of all deliveries within the catchment area and used difference‐in‐differences analysis to determine the intervention's effect on facility utilisation for childbirth. We conducted a secondary analysis of utilisation among women whose prior delivery was at home. We further investigated mechanisms for increased facility utilisation. Results The intervention led to an increase in facility births of 6.7 percentage points from a baseline of 72% (95% Confidence Interval: 0.6, 12.8). The intervention increased facility delivery among women with past home deliveries by 18.3 percentage points (95% CI: 10.1, 26.6). Antenatal quality increased in intervention facilities with providers performing an additional 0.5 actions across the full population and 0.8 actions for the home delivery subgroup. Conclusions We attribute the increased use of facilities to better antenatal quality. This increased utilisation would lead to lower maternal mortality only in the presence of improvement in care quality.

Abstract
Background: Poor health system experiences negatively affect the lives of poor people throughout the world. In East Africa, there is a growing body of evidence of poor quality care that in some cases is so poor that it is disrespectful or abusive. This study will assess whether community feedback through report cards (with and without non-financial rewards) can improve patient experience, which includes aspects of patient dignity, autonomy, confidentiality, communication, timely attention, quality of basic amenities, and social support. Methods/Design: This cluster-randomized controlled study will randomize 75 primary health care facilities in rural Pwani Region, Tanzania to one of three arms: private feedback (intervention), social recognition reward through public reporting (intervention), or no feedback (control). Within both intervention arms, we will give the providers at the study facilities feedback on the quality of patient experience the facility provides (aggregate results from all providers) using data from patient surveys. The quality indicators that we report will address specific experiences, be observable by patients, fall into well-identified domains of patient experience, and be within the realm of action by healthcare providers. For example, we will measure the proportion of patients who report that providers definitely “explained things in a way that was easy to understand.” This feedback will be delivered by a medical doctor to all the providers at the facility in a small group session. A formal discussion guide will be used. Facilities randomized to the social recognition intervention reward arm will have two additional opportunities for social recognition. First, a poster that displays their achieved level of patient experience will be publicly posted at the health facility and village government offices. Second, recognition from senior officials at the local NGO and/or the Ministry of Health will be given to the facility with the best or most-improved patient experience ratings at endline. We will use surveys with parents/guardians of sick children to measure patient experience, and surveys with healthcare providers to assess potential mechanisms of effect. Conclusion: Results from this study will provide evidence for whether, and through what mechanisms, patient reported feedback can affect interpersonal quality of care. Abstract
Objective To determine the effective coverage of obstetric care in a rural Tanzanian region and to assess differences in effective coverage by wealth. Design Cross-sectional structured interviews. Setting Pwani Region, Tanzania. Participants The study includes 24 rural, government-managed, primary healthcare clinics and their catchment populations. From January-April 2016, we conducted a household survey of a census of women with recent deliveries, health worker knowledge surveys and facility audits. Main Outcome Measures We explored the proportion of women receiving quality care through the cascade and conducted an equity analysis by wealth. Results In total, 2,910 of 3,564 women (81.6%) reported delivering their most recent child in a health facility, 1,096 of whom delivered in a study facility. Using a minimum threshold of quality, the effective coverage of obstetric care was 25%. Quality was lowest in the emergency care dimensions, with the average score on the provider knowledge tests at 47% and the average provision of basic emergency obstetric services below 50%. The wealthiest 20% of women were 4.1 times as likely to deliver in facilities offering at least the minimum threshold of quality care through the cascade compared to the poorest 80% of women (95% confidence interval: 1.5-11.3). Conclusions Effective coverage of delivery care is very low, particularly among poorer women. Health worker knowledge caused the sharpest decline in effective coverage. Measures of effective coverage are a better performance measure of under-resourced health systems than utilization. Abstract
Objectives To assess the prevalence of high blood pressure amongst postpartum women in rural Tanzania, and to explore factors associated with hypertension prevalence, awareness, treatment, and control. Methods 1849 women in Tanzania's Pwani Region who delivered a child in the prior year participated in the study. We measured blood pressure, administered a structured questionnaire and assessed factors associated with the prevalence, awareness, treatment, and control of hypertension (HTN) using bivariable and multivariable logistic regressions. Findings 26.7% of women had high blood pressure and/or were taking antihypertensive medication. Women were on average 27.5 years old (range 15-54). Nearly all women (99.5%) reported contact with the health system during their pregnancy and delivery, with an average of 5.2 visits for their own care in the past year. Only 23.5% of those with HTN were aware of their diagnosis, 17.4% were taking medication, and only 10.5% had controlled blood pressure. In multivariable analysis, facility delivery, health insurance, and increased distance from a hospital were associated with increased likelihood of HTN awareness; facility delivery and hospital distance were associated with current hypertensive treatment; younger age and increased hospital distance were associated with control of HTN. Conclusion The prevalence of high blood pressure in this postpartum population was high, and despite frequent recent contacts with the health system, awareness, treatment and control of HTN were low. These findings highlight an important missed opportunity to improve women's health during antenatal and postnatal care.

Abstract
AIM To describe factors associated with pregnancy desire and dual method use among people living with HIV in clinical care in sub-Saharan Africa. DESIGN Sexually active HIV-positive adults were enrolled in 18 HIV clinics in Kenya, Namibia and Tanzania. Demographic, clinical and reproductive health data were captured by interview and medical record abstraction. Correlates of desiring a pregnancy within the next 6 months, and dual method use [defined as consistent condom use together with a highly effective method of contraception (hormonal, intrauterine device (IUD), permanent)], among those not desiring pregnancy, were identified using logistic regression. RESULTS Among 3375 participants (median age 37 years, 42% male, 64% on antiretroviral treatment), 565 (17%) desired a pregnancy within the next 6 months. Of those with no short-term fertility desire (n=2542), 686 (27%) reported dual method use, 250 (10%) highly effective contraceptive use only, 1332 (52%) condom use only, and 274 (11%) no protection. Respondents were more likely to desire a pregnancy if they were from Namibia and Tanzania, male, had a primary education, were married/cohabitating, and had fewer children. Factors associated with increased likelihood of dual method use included being female, being comfortable asking a partner to use a condom, and communication with a health care provider about family planning. Participants who perceived that their partner wanted a pregnancy were less likely to report dual method use. CONCLUSIONS There was low dual method use and low use of highly effective contraception. Contraceptive protection was predominantly through condom-only use. These findings demonstrate the importance of integrating reproductive health services into routine HIV care.

Abstract
BACKGROUND To evaluate the on-going scale-up of HIV programs, we assessed trends in patient characteristics at enrolment and ART initiation over 7 years of implementation. METHODS Data were from Optimal Models, a prospective open cohort study of HIV-infected (HIV+) adults (≥15 years) and children (<15 years) enrolled from January 2005 to December 2011 at 44 HIV clinics in 3 regions of mainland Tanzania (Kagera, Kigoma, Pwani) and Zanzibar. Comparative statistics for trends in characteristics of patients enrolled in 2005-2007, 2008-2009 and 2010-2011 were examined. RESULTS Overall 62,801 HIV + patients were enrolled: 58,102(92.5%) adults, (66.5% female); 4,699(7.5%) children.Among adults, pregnant women enrolment increased: 6.8%, 2005-2007; 12.1%, 2008-2009; 17.2%, 2010-2011; as did entry into care from prevention of mother-to-child HIV transmission (PMTCT) programs: 6.6%, 2005-2007; 9.5%, 2008-2009; 12.6%, 2010-2011. WHO stage IV at enrolment declined: 27.1%, 2005-2007; 20.2%, 2008-2009; 11.1% 2010-2011. Of the 42.5% and 29.5% with CD4+ data at enrolment and ART initiation respectively, median CD4+ count increased: 210 cells/μL, 2005-2007; 262 cells/μL, 2008-2009; 266 cells/μL 2010-2011; but median CD4+ at ART initiation did not change (148 cells/μL overall). Stavudine initiation declined: 84.9%, 2005-2007; 43.1%, 2008-2009; 19.7%, 2010-2011.Among children, median age (years) at enrolment decreased from 6.1(IQR:2.7-10.0) in 2005-2007 to 4.8(IQR:1.9-8.6) in 2008-2009, and 4.1(IQR:1.5-8.1) in 2010-2011 and children <24 months increased from 18.5% to 26.1% and 31.5% respectively. Entry from PMTCT was 7.0%, 2005-2007; 10.7%, 2008-2009; 15.0%, 2010-2011. WHO stage IV at enrolment declined from 22.9%, 2005-2007, to 18.3%, 2008-2009 to 13.9%, 2010-2011. Proportion initiating stavudine was 39.8% 2005-2007; 39.5%, 2008-2009; 26.1%, 2010-2011. Median age at ART initiation also declined significantly. CONCLUSIONS Over time, the proportion of pregnant women and of adults and children enrolled from PMTCT programs increased. There was a decline in adults and children with advanced HIV disease at enrolment and initiation of stavudine. Pediatric age at enrolment and ART initiation declined. Results suggest HIV program maturation from an emergency response.

Abstract
HIV care and treatment settings provide an opportunity to reach people living with HIV/AIDS (PLHIV) with prevention messages and services. Population-based surveys in sub-Saharan Africa have identified HIV risk behaviors among PLHIV, yet data are limited regarding HIV risk behaviors of PLHIV in clinical care. This paper describes the baseline sociodemographic, HIV transmission risk behaviors, and clinical data of a study evaluating an HIV prevention intervention package for HIV care and treatment clinics in Africa. The study was a longitudinal group-randomized trial in 9 intervention clinics and 9 comparison clinics in Kenya, Namibia, and Tanzania (N = 3538). Baseline participants were mostly female, married, had less than a primary education, and were relatively recently diagnosed with HIV. Fifty-two percent of participants had a partner of negative or unknown status, 24% were not using condoms consistently, and 11% reported STI symptoms in the last 6 months. There were differences in demographic and HIV transmission risk variables by country, indicating the need to consider local context in designing studies and using caution when generalizing findings across African countries. Baseline data from this study indicate that participants were often engaging in HIV transmission risk behaviors, which supports the need for prevention with PLHIV (PwP).

Abstract
CONTEXT There are concerns that malaria control measures such as use of insecticide-treated bed nets, by delaying acquisition of immunity, might result in an increase in the more severe manifestations of malaria. An understanding of the relationships among the level of exposure to Plasmodium falciparum, age, and severity of malaria can provide evidence of whether this is likely. OBJECTIVE To describe the clinical manifestations and case fatality of severe P falciparum malaria at varying altitudes resulting in varying levels of transmission. DESIGN, SETTING, AND PATIENTS A total of 1984 patients admitted for severe malaria to 10 hospitals serving populations living at levels of transmission varying from very low (altitude >1200 m) to very high (altitude <600 m) in a defined area of northeastern Tanzania, studied prospectively from February 2002 to February 2003. Data were analyzed in a logistic regression model and adjusted for potential clustering within hospitals. MAIN OUTCOME MEASURES Specific syndromes of severe malaria; mortality. RESULTS The median age of patients was 1 year in high transmission, 3 years in moderate transmission, and 5 years in low transmission areas. The odds of severe malarial anemia (hemoglobin <5 g/dL) peaked at 1 year of age at high transmission and at 2 years at moderate and low transmission intensities and then decreased with increasing age (P = .002). Odds were highest in infants (0-1 year: referent; 2-4 years: odds ratio [OR], 0.83; 95% confidence interval [CI], 0.72-0.96), 5 to <15 years: OR, 0.44; 95% CI, 0.27-0.72; > or =15 years: OR, 0.44; 95% CI, 0.27-0.73; P<.001) and high transmission intensity areas (altitude <600 m: referent; 600 m to 1200 m: OR, 0.55; 95% CI, 0.35-0.84; >1200 m: OR, 0.55; 95% CI, 0.26-1.15; P for trend = .03). The odds of cerebral malaria were significantly higher in low transmission intensity areas (altitude of residence <600 m: referent; 600 m to 1200 m: OR, 3.17; 95% CI, 1.32-7.60; >1200 m: OR, 3.76; 95% CI, 1.96-7.18; P for trend = .003) and with age 5 years and older (0-1 year: referent; 2-4 years: OR, 1.57; 95% CI, 0.82-2.99; 5 to <15 years: OR, 6.07; 95% CI, 2.98-12.38; > or =15 years: OR, 6.24; 95% CI, 3.47-11.21; P<.001). The overall case-fatality rate of 7% (139 deaths) was similar at high and moderate levels of transmission but increased to 13% in low transmission areas (P = .03), an increase explained by the increase in the proportion of cases with cerebral malaria. CONCLUSIONS Age and level of exposure independently influence the clinical presentation of severe malaria. Our study suggests that an increase in the proportion of cases with more fatal manifestations of severe malaria is likely to occur only after transmission has been reduced to low levels where the overall incidence is likely to be low.

Abstract
Hospital-acquired infections (HAI) are a major and largely preventable cause of morbidity and morbidity worldwide. Very few reports on the prevalence of HAI in sub-Saharan Africa have been published and most of those that have appeared in the press have focused on surgical-wound infection. In the present, questionnaire-based, point-prevalence study, in which the doctor on the ward round was used as the primary informant, the prevalences of all HAI among all the inpatients at a tertiary referral hospital in northern Tanzania were estimated. On the day of the study, there were 412 inpatients (in 15 ward areas) and 61 cases of HAI were identified, giving an overall HAI prevalence of 14.8%. The prevalences of HAI were particularly high in the medical intensive-care unit (40%), the surgical (orthopaedic and general surgery) wards (36.7%), and one of the general medical wards (22.2%). Factors associated with a patient having a HAI were hospitalization for >30 days [odds ratio (OR) = 4.07; 95% confidence interval (CI) = 2.07-7.99]; being a patient on the orthopaedic and general surgical ward known as 'Surgical 2' (OR = 2.14; CI = 1.02-4.46); and being referred from another health facility (OR = 1.90; CI = 1.02-3.42). The most commonly identified HAI in the hospital were urinary-tract infections (14 cases), followed by surgical-wound infections (10 cases) and then lower respiratory-tract infections (six cases). Twenty HAI were 'unspecified'. The study was rapid and cheap to carry out. The results not only gave a baseline estimate of HAI in the study setting but also identified key areas for interventions to reduce HAI.
